repo.or.cz
/
polly-mirror.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[ScopInfo] Allow epilogues to be the main statement of a BB.
2017-04-13
Michael Kr
u
se
[DeLICM] Rena
m
e
K
nowl
e
dg
e
to Knowled
g
eStr
.
NFC
.
commit
|
commitdiff
|
tree
2017-04-05
Michael K
r
u
s
e
Re
m
o
ve llvm
.
lifetime
.
start
/
end in or
i
gina
l
region
.
commit
|
commitdiff
|
tree
2017-04-03
M
i
chael Kruse
[test] Fix two
testcases
.
NFC
.
commit
|
commitdiff
|
tree
2017-04-03
Michael Kruse
[ScopInfo] Fix typos
in
option
descr
i
ption
.
commit
|
commitdiff
|
tree
2017-03-23
M
i
chae
l
Kruse
[
S
co
p
I
n
fo
]
Introduce Sc
o
pS
t
m
t
::contains(BB*)
.
NF
C
.
commit
|
commitdiff
|
tree
2017-03-22
M
i
chael Kruse
[DeLICM] Add const qualifier
s
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-22
Michael Kr
u
se
[
Suppo
r
t] Add function
s
to IS
L
Tools
.
commit
|
commitdiff
|
tree
2017-03-22
Michae
l
Kruse
[
D
eLICM] Re
m
ove ove
r
l
o
aded Kno
w
le
d
ge cons
t
r
uct
o
r
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-22
Mi
c
hae
l
K
r
use
[D
e
LICM] Remove AllEleme
n
ts
.
N
F
C
.
commit
|
commitdiff
|
tree
2017-03-20
Mi
c
ha
e
l Kruse
[DeLICM] Re
f
ector out parseSetOrNul
l
.
NFC
.
commit
|
commitdiff
|
tree
2017-03-20
Michael Kr
u
se
[D
e
LIC
M
] A
d
d
f
orgotten isl_s
p
a
c
e
_
set_tuple_id in u
n
i
ttests
.
commit
|
commitdiff
|
tree
2017-03-17
Michael Kruse
Re
v
ert "Re
m
ove refere
n
ces to
A
ss
u
m
p
tion
C
ache
.
NFC
.
"
commit
|
commitdiff
|
tree
2017-03-17
M
i
chael Kruse
[ScopInfo/Prune
U
npro
f
itable
]
Mo
v
e d
e
fault p
r
ofita
b
ility
.
.
.
commit
|
commitdiff
|
tree
2017-03-17
Michael Kruse
[PruneUnprofitab
l
e] Add
-
polly-pr
u
ne-unprofitable pass
.
commit
|
commitdiff
|
tree
2017-03-15
Micha
e
l Kr
u
se
[Sc
o
pInfo] Introdu
c
e ScopSt
m
t::get
S
urr
o
u
ndingLoop(
.
.
.
commit
|
commitdiff
|
tree
2017-03-10
Michael K
r
use
[Si
m
p
l
ify] Add -polly-simplify pass
.
commit
|
commitdiff
|
tree
2017-03-10
Michael Kruse
[Sup
p
ort] Correct file
n
a
me
in file he
a
d commen
t
.
N
FC
.
commit
|
commitdiff
|
tree
2017-03-09
Michael Kruse
[Support] Add -polly-dump-module
p
ass
.
commit
|
commitdiff
|
tree
2017-03-09
Michael
Kruse
[Cmake] Generate a PollyCo
n
fig
.
cmake
.
commit
|
commitdiff
|
tree
2017-03-09
Michae
l
Kruse
[DeLICM]
Add -polly-delicm-over
a
pproxim
a
te-writ
e
s optio
n
.
commit
|
commitdiff
|
tree
2017-03-08
Michael K
r
use
[DeadCod
e
Elim] Put -polly-dce-pre
c
i
s
e-
s
teps into the
.
.
.
commit
|
commitdiff
|
tree
2017-03-08
Michael
K
ruse
[ScopDetection] Only allow SCoP-wid
e
available base
.
.
.
commit
|
commitdiff
|
tree
2017-03-07
Mic
h
ael
Kruse
[
ScopDetection] Require LoadInst b
a
se point
e
r
s to be
.
.
.
commit
|
commitdiff
|
tree
2017-02-27
Michael Kruse
[Cmake] Optionally
u
se a sy
s
tem isl
version
.
commit
|
commitdiff
|
tree
2017-02-27
Michael
Kruse
[D
e
L
ICM] A
d
d nomap regressions tests
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-27
Mi
c
hael
K
r
use
[DeLI
C
M] Sta
t
ist
i
cs for use in r
e
gression t
e
s
t
s
.
commit
|
commitdiff
|
tree
2017-02-23
Mic
h
ael
K
ruse
[DeLI
C
M] Fortify ag
a
ins
t
excee
d
ing isl's max operatio
n
s
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Kruse
[Support] Remov
e
NonowningIslPtr
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
M
i
c
h
ael
K
ruse
[Dependence
I
n
f
o
] R
e
move unused variabl
e
.
N
FC
.
commit
|
commitdiff
|
tree
2017-02-23
M
i
chael Kruse
[DependenceInfo] Use r
e
ferences instead o
f
d
o
uble pointers
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Kruse
[Depend
e
n
c
e
I
nfo] Rename
S
tmtScheduleDo
m
ain -> Tagge
d
S
tmt
D
oma
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Kruse
[Dependenc
e
In
f
o] Simplify use
o
f
S
tmtSchedule's d
o
main
.
.
.
commit
|
commitdiff
|
tree
2017-02-23
Micha
e
l Kru
s
e
Rem
o
ve all
refer
e
nces to PostDominators
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
Michael Kru
s
e
[DeLI
C
M] Add
m
is
s
ing
D
oxygen comment
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-23
M
ich
a
el Kruse
[
De
L
ICM]
Ca
p
italize parame
t
er
n
ame
.
N
F
C
.
commit
|
commitdiff
|
tree
2017-02-23
M
i
chael Kruse
[DeL
I
CM] Regre
s
sion test for ski
p
p
i
n
g
map t
a
rgets
.
commit
|
commitdiff
|
tree
2017-02-22
Michael
Kruse
[D
e
LICM] Add reg
r
ession te
s
ts for
DeLI
C
M
re
j
ect cases
.
commit
|
commitdiff
|
tree
2017-02-22
Michael
K
ruse
[DeLICM] Fix wr
o
ng comment
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-22
Mic
h
ael Kruse
[DeLICM] Print message w
h
en zone analysi
s
is
not
a
vailable
.
.
.
commit
|
commitdiff
|
tree
2017-02-22
Michael K
r
use
[DeLICM
]
Use opt<int>
.
commit
|
commitdiff
|
tree
2017-02-21
M
ichael K
r
us
e
[DeLICM] M
a
p val
u
e
s
h
oisted by
L
ICM back to the array
.
commit
|
commitdiff
|
tree
2017-02-20
Michael Kruse
[Cmake] Bump required cmake
version to
3
.
4
.
3
.
commit
|
commitdiff
|
tree
2017-02-20
Michael Kruse
[Cmak
e
] Install
t
h
e
isl
hea
d
ers into the install tree
.
commit
|
commitdiff
|
tree
2017-02-15
Mi
c
hael Kruse
[DeLICM]
Add
forgotte
n
un
i
ttest
s
in previous commi
t
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
Michae
l
K
r
use
[DeLICM] Add Knowledg
e
c
l
ass
.
N
F
C
.
commit
|
commitdiff
|
tree
2017-02-05
Michael
K
r
u
s
e
[External]
M
o
ve li
b
/
J
S
ON to
l
ib/Ext
e
rna
l
/JSON
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-04
Mich
a
el Kr
u
se
[Support] Add convertZone
T
oTimepoints
.
N
F
C
.
commit
|
commitdiff
|
tree
2017-02-04
M
i
chael Kruse
[Su
p
port] A
d
d c
o
mput
e
ArrayUnu
s
e
d
.
N
FC
.
commit
|
commitdiff
|
tree
2017-02-04
M
ichae
l
K
r
use
[Suppor
t
] Add compute
R
eachin
g
Wri
t
e
.
NFC
.
commit
|
commitdiff
|
tree
2017-02-03
Mic
h
ael Kruse
[Support] Remove unused function
h
asInvokeEdge
.
NFC
.
commit
|
commitdiff
|
tree
2017-01-27
Mi
c
hael
Kruse
[Su
p
p
o
r
t] Add general
isl
t
ools for DeLICM
.
N
FC
.
commit
|
commitdiff
|
tree
2017-01-27
M
ichae
l
Kruse
[
C
odePrepa] Remove unus
e
d
d
eclara
t
ion
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-15
Mic
h
a
el Kruse
Re
m
o
v
e refere
n
c
e
s to As
s
u
mpti
o
nCache
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-12
Michael Kruse
[Schedu
l
eOptim
i
z
e
r
] Fix mem
o
ry leak
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-07
Michael Kruse
Ad
d
unitte
s
t
s
f
or
f
oreac
h
(Elt|Piece)
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-07
M
ichael Kr
u
se
Add more ISL for
e
achElt functions
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-07
M
i
chae
l
Kru
s
e
Add IslPtr typ
e
t
raits
.
NFC
.
commit
|
commitdiff
|
tree
2016-12-06
M
i
chael Kruse
Update to isl-0
.
17
.
1-314-g3
1
06e8d
commit
|
commitdiff
|
tree
2016-11-29
Michael K
r
use
[DeLICM]
A
dd
pa
s
s boilerp
l
at
e
c
ode
.
commit
|
commitdiff
|
tree
2016-11-29
M
ichae
l
K
ruse
canSynthesize: Re
m
o
v
e unused argu
m
ent LI
.
N
F
C
.
commit
|
commitdiff
|
tree
2016-11-03
Michael K
r
use
[
S
copInfo] F
i
x
is
l
object leak
.
commit
|
commitdiff
|
tree
2016-10-25
Michael Kruse
[ScopInfo]
F
ix: use
raw
s
ource pointer
.
commit
|
commitdiff
|
tree
2016-10-20
Michael Kruse
[cmake]
A
voi
d
war
n
ings in feature tes
t
s
.
NFC
.
commit
|
commitdiff
|
tree
2016-10-18
Mic
h
ael K
r
use
[test] F
i
x buildb
o
t
aft
e
r SCEV
c
h
ange
.
commit
|
commitdiff
|
tree
2016-10-17
M
i
chael Kr
u
se
[ScopDetect
]
Dep
e
nd
t
ransitive
l
y o
n
S
c
alar
E
volution
.
commit
|
commitdiff
|
tree
2016-10-16
Mic
h
ael Kruse
[test] Add
missing colon
.
commit
|
commitdiff
|
tree
2016-10-16
M
i
chael Kruse
[
c
m
a
k
e] A
d
d polly-isl-te
s
t d
e
p
e
nde
n
cy
t
o lit test
s
.
commit
|
commitdiff
|
tree
2016-10-16
Michael Kru
s
e
[cmake] Add poll
y
-isl-test depend
e
ncy to l
i
t tests
.
commit
|
commitdiff
|
tree
2016-10-16
Michael Kr
u
s
e
[tes
t
]
Add -polly-unprofitable-scalar-accs to t
e
st
.
.
.
commit
|
commitdiff
|
tree
2016-10-12
Mic
h
a
el Kruse
[ScopInfo/Cod
e
Gen] ExitPHI reads are implicit
.
commit
|
commitdiff
|
tree
2016-10-10
Mi
c
hael Kruse
[DepInfo] Print -d
e
bu
g
output out
s
i
de of max-operations
.
.
.
commit
|
commitdiff
|
tree
2016-10-10
Michael Kr
u
se
[
S
upport/De
p
Info] Introduce IslMaxOperationsGuard a
n
d
.
.
.
commit
|
commitdiff
|
tree
2016-10-07
M
i
c
hael K
r
u
se
[
cmake] Unify di
s
abli
n
g upstream pr
o
ject warn
i
ngs
.
commit
|
commitdiff
|
tree
2016-10-07
Michael Kruse
[cmake]
M
ove is
l
_test
a
rt
i
facts to Po
l
l
y
fold
e
r
.
commit
|
commitdiff
|
tree
2016-10-04
Michael
Kru
s
e
[Sco
p
Info] Add -poll
y
-unprofi
t
a
b
le
-
sc
a
lar-accs
option
.
commit
|
commitdiff
|
tree
2016-10-04
Michael
K
r
use
[ScopInfo] Sc
a
lar
acces
s
do not have indi
r
ect
b
ase
.
.
.
commit
|
commitdiff
|
tree
2016-10-04
M
i
chael Kruse
[
ScopInfo] Make simplify
S
CoP() pu
b
lic
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
Michael
K
ruse
[CodeGen] Add a
s
sertion f
o
r in
d
irect array index exp
r
ess
i
on
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
M
ichael Kruse
[Support] Complet
e
ISL
annot
a
tions
to
IslPtr<>
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
M
ic
h
ael Kruse
[S
u
pp
o
rt] Co
m
pile f
i
x
for
g
cc
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
Michae
l
Kr
u
se
[Support] Add (Nono
w
ning-)
I
slPtr::dump()
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-30
Michae
l
Kruse
[Support] Call isl_*
_
fre
e
() only on non
-
null
p
ointers
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
M
i
c
hael Kruse
[CodeGen
]
C
ha
n
ge 'Scalar' t
o
'Array' in meth
o
d
n
am
e
s
.
.
.
commit
|
commitdiff
|
tree
2016-09-30
Michael Kru
s
e
[CodeGen]
A
d
d a
s
s
ertion f
o
r parti
a
l scala
r
acce
s
ses
.
.
.
commit
|
commitdiff
|
tree
2016-09-13
Michael Kruse
U
se v
a
lue directly instead of reference
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-12
Michael Krus
e
Remove -fvisibility=h
i
d
d
e
n
an
d
FORCE_STATIC
.
commit
|
commitdiff
|
tree
2016-09-08
Micha
e
l Kruse
Add
-
polly
-
f
l
atten-sched
u
le
p
ass
.
commit
|
commitdiff
|
tree
2016-09-07
Michael Kru
s
e
D
i
s
a
b
le
M
S
V
C
warnings on ISL
.
commit
|
commitdiff
|
tree
2016-09-05
Michael
Kr
u
se
Ad
d
chec
k
-polly-tes
t
s build target
.
commit
|
commitdiff
|
tree
2016-09-01
M
i
chael Kruse
A
l
low mapping scala
r
MemoryAc
c
es
s
es to array element
s
.
commit
|
commitdiff
|
tree
2016-09-01
Mic
h
a
el Kruse
Che
c
k
va
l
idity of new access r
e
lation
s
.
NFC
.
commit
|
commitdiff
|
tree
2016-09-01
Michael
K
r
use
[
ScopInfo]
A
dd missing ISL ann
o
t
ations NFC
.
commit
|
commitdiff
|
tree
2016-09-01
M
ichae
l
K
ruse
U
p
dat
e
ISL to
isl-0
.
17
.
1-
2
03
-
g3fef8
9
8
.
commit
|
commitdiff
|
tree
2016-08-26
Mich
a
el Kruse
Add space between a
c
c
e
ss string an
d
fo
l
l
o
w-
u
p
.
commit
|
commitdiff
|
tree
2016-08-26
M
i
chael Kruse
Add "New
access functi
o
n" to update_check
.
py
classif
i
er
.
commit
|
commitdiff
|
tree
2016-08-25
M
ichael Kru
s
e
Query llv
m
-config to
get system
l
ibs required
for linking
.
commit
|
commitdiff
|
tree
2016-08-25
Michael Kruse
A
d
d comment for
q
uerying --l
i
bdir
.
NFC
.
commit
|
commitdiff
|
tree
2016-08-25
Michael Kr
u
se
Do not build u
n
ittest
s
by def
a
ult
.
commit
|
commitdiff
|
tree
2016-08-25
Mic
h
a
el Kruse
A
dd mis
s
i
n
g words to wanrning
.
commit
|
commitdiff
|
tree
2016-08-25
M
icha
e
l
K
ruse
Ad
d
warning for FORC
E
_
STATIC li
b
raries whe
n
using BU
I
L
D_SHAR
.
.
.
commit
|
commitdiff
|
tree
next